PM to address nation from Rara Lake on New Year

Published On: April 13, 2018 12:47 PM NPT By: Republica  | @RepublicaNepal


KATHMANDU, April 13: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li has been scheduled to address from Rara Lake on the occasion of Nepali New Year 2075 in the name of public. For this, Prime Minister Oli has left Mugu district from Kathmandu.

PM Oli will inaugurate the Karnali Rara Tourism Year in Rara Lake on April 14 (Baisakh 1).  He will also launch the School Admission Campaign too from Mugu on the same day.

PM Oli is scheduled to visit Dhorpatan Hunting Reserve in Baglung before arriving in Dolpa this evening.

The cabinet meeting of Karnali Province on March 10 decided to observe the Nepali New Year as Rara-Karnali Visit Year-2075.

The Karnali province government has requested all domestic and international tourists to visit Rara once in a lifetime to experience natural beauties of Karnali.

The government believed that the campaign will help foster the lifestyle of citizens of Karnali region.
